Kwik Brain is a fun, fast-paced show designed to help busy people learn and achieve anything in a fraction of the time! Your coach, Jim Kwik (his real name), is the brain & memory trainer to elite mental performers, including many of the world’s leading CEO’s and celebrities. In this easy to digest bite-sized podcast, you will discover Kwik’s favorite shortcuts to read faster, remember more, and ‘supercharge’ your greatest wealth-building asset: your brain. Whether you’re a student, senior, entrepreneur or educator, you will get the edge with these simple actionable tools to sharpen your mind, enhance your focus, and fast-track your fullest potential. Get show notes, Jim’s latest brain-training, and submit your questions in our private community (free) at: www.KwikBrain.com Jim Kwik is the founder of KwikLearning.com, a widely recognized world leader in speed-reading, memory improvement, brain performance, and accelerated learning with students in over 150 countries. After a childhood brain injury left him learning-challenged, Kwik created strategies to dramatically enhance his mental performance. He has since dedicated his life to helping others unleash their true genius and brainpower to learn anything faster and live a life of greater power, productivity, and purpose.© 508521

    Most people think feeling tired, foggy, inflamed, and “off” is just part of modern life.

    But what if your body is working overtime behind the scenes trying to protect you from a toxic load your grandparents never had to deal with?

    In this episode of the Kwik Brain podcast, I sit down with David Roberts and Dr. John Gildea, founders of Mara Labs, to unpack what modern toxins, chronic inflammation, and microplastics may be doing to your brain, gut, energy, and recovery.

    David Roberts’ interest in this work began after his late wife, Mara, was diagnosed with breast cancer, a deeply personal experience that pushed him to look more closely at the science of cellular protection and detoxification. Dr. John Gildea is a Johns Hopkins-trained PhD and molecular biologist with decades of research experience in oxidative stress, gene expression, and the body’s natural defense systems.

    We talk about what is really happening when your body feels slower to recover, why brain fog may be one of the earliest warning signs that your system is under stress, and how your detox pathways, inflammation levels, and gut barrier all play a role in how sharp or sluggish you feel.

    In this episode, you’ll learn:

    ☑️ What sulforaphane is and why it matters for brain health, detoxification, and inflammation

    ☑️ How chronic inflammation differs from the kind your body uses for healing

    ☑️ Why brain fog may be linked to toxins, mitochondrial strain, and poor cellular cleanup

    ☑️ What microplastics are, where most exposure comes from, and why they are such a concern

    ☑️ How modern life may be overwhelming the body’s built-in defense systems

    ☑️ Why detox is not about extreme cleanses but about supporting the pathways your body already uses

    ☑️ How gut integrity and tight junctions relate to toxic burden

    ☑️ Simple ways to reduce toxic exposure and support your body more effectively

    If you’ve been feeling like your energy is lower, your thinking is less clear, or your body is not recovering the way it used to, this episode will help you understand what may be happening underneath the surface and what you can do to better support your brain and body in a high-stress, high-toxin world.

    Most people say they want to keep learning.

    But when life gets busy, attention gets fragmented, and the to-do list keeps growing, learning is often the first thing that disappears.

    In this episode of the Kwik Brain podcast, I break down practical strategies to make lifelong learning a real part of your life, even when time and attention are limited.

    Because personal growth does not happen by accident. It happens when you build systems that make learning easier to start and easier to sustain.

    I share simple ways to prioritize learning, use micro-learning, create a daily routine, choose better resources, and turn passive consumption into active growth. We also talk about how to use your calendar, your environment, and your community to make learning a daily practice.

    In this episode, you will learn:

    ✅ Why lifelong learning is one of the best investments you can make in yourself

    ✅ How to create a “learn list” instead of only a to-do list

    ✅ Why micro-learning works when time and attention are limited

    ✅ How to build learning into your morning, commute, workouts, or weekly routine

    ✅ Why active learning helps information stick better than passive review

    ✅ How to use implementation and teaching to deepen understanding

    ✅ Why time-blocking and the 1% rule make learning easier to sustain

    ✅ How spaced repetition strengthens memory and long-term retention

    ✅ Why curiosity, mentors, and community make growth more sustainable

    This episode is about making learning so consistent that it becomes part of who you are.

    Because first you create your habits, then your habits create you.

    If you want to keep growing, stay relevant, and make learning feel realistic instead of overwhelming, this episode will show you how to build a system that works in real life.

    Most students study the same way for every subject.

    But what if that is the exact reason so much of what you study never sticks?

    In this episode of the Kwik Brain podcast, I break down why one-size-fits-all studying fails and how to match your study strategy to the type of subject you are learning. Because the way your brain processes math is different from how it remembers history or understands literature.

    I share brain-based techniques from neuroscience, memory science, and learning psychology that can help you absorb, retain, and recall information faster, whether you are preparing for finals, standardized tests, or just want to learn more effectively.

    In this episode, you will learn:

    ✅ Why studying every subject the same way hurts retention

    ✅ How to make history easier to remember using story, melody, and memory palaces

    ✅ Why math sticks better when you use movement, interleaving, and delayed feedback

    ✅ How to study literature using mind mapping, teaching, and emotional connection

    ✅ Why the Pomodoro technique can help you focus without burning out

    ✅ How movement and hydration improve learning and recall

    ✅ Why all-nighters sabotage memory and sleep helps lock learning in

    ✅ How changing locations or using scent can create stronger retrieval cues

    ✅ How to match the tool to the task so studying becomes easier and more effective

    This is about studying in a way your brain actually understands, remembers, and can use when it matters most.
